udf-trailmix

Aerospike UDF mixes

Aerospike is a higher performance cluster aware key-value datastore. It supports User Defined Function (UDF) which is code written in Lua programming language and runs inside the Aerospike database server. UDFs can be dynamically loaded into the Aerospike Cluster to created extended capability.

udf-trailmix contains lua examples. Enjoy !!!

Setup

  1. Download and Install : http://www.aerospike.com/free-aerospike-3-community-edition/
  2. Start Aerospike : sudo /etc/init.d/aerospike start

Quick Usage

Download .lua files to the local directory. Run aql (https://docs.aerospike.com/pages/viewpage.action?pageId=3807532)

example:

  • aql> Register Module './redis.lua'
  • aql> Execute redis.LPUSH('tweets', 'my simple tweet') on test.demo where PK = '1'
  • aql> Execute redis.LPOP("tweets", 10) on test.demo where PK='1'
